I'm trying to synchronize my WindowsCE device (Smartphone) with KDE apps, at least the calendar, and I understood of several poeple in this forum it shoule be possible. But I cant get it to work.
I installed everything needed (and even unneeded); i have kitchensynk, synce(-kde), raki, multisynk, KDEPIM, kmail, kalendar, the kernel modules etc.
I can make a connection with the smartphone, browse its files, have the raki traybar icon connected, see the stats via raki and pstatus, etcetera. But no synchronisation. I understood the syncing plugins for KDE you see in raki still have to be written, and are just placeholders, and have to use kitchensynk, but that last program also I cant figure out.
So, can anybody point me in the right direction? _how do i actually synchronize my calendar_??
I believe i've seen that evolution can actually sync with synce, but i dont want to pull in 50Mb of packages (I dont have GNOME on my system) just to try out of, maybe, evolution (wich thus doesnt integrate in my desktop) will synchronize my calendar. If nothing else will help, i'll have to switch to GNOME, can anyboy confirm it'll work in there?
